Latency issue with a wireless USB adapter

I bought a D-Link DWA-127 wireless USB adapter for Raspberry Pi to stream music to a living room, but the adapter seems to have a latency issue. If I ping from the adapter to RT-N66U, I get a constant latency:

9 packets transmitted, 9 received, 0% packet loss, time 8013ms
rtt min/avg/max/mdev = 1.314/6.865/11.958/2.519 ms

But if I ping from RT-N66U to adapter, latencies are all over the place:

9 packets transmitted, 9 packets received, 0% packet loss
round-trip min/avg/max = 23.496/94.327/199.948 ms

This makes streaming, and actually any use difficult. Situation is the same if I use the adapter in my laptop. There are no other networks on a 2.4GHz channel I use, only my g and n devices. RT-N66U has a 3.0.0.4.374_168 fw.

Anyone seen this kind of uneven latencies? Any cure for this or is the adapter just a piece of crap?
 
I managed to resolve the latency issue by turning the power management of DWA-127 off. Now it is usable but did it help streaming? Not really. I guess if a sender and a receiver are in the same 2.4GHz band you can forget at least PCM audio streaming.

Anyone having ideas what settings for wireless could improve throughput? Signal quality is very good for both ends. If nothing else helps, I'll buy 5GHz wireless card for the desktop, so at least the serder and the receiver are on different bands.
